タグ付けされた質問 「php」

PHPは、主にサーバー側のWeb開発用に設計された、広く使用されている、高レベルで動的なオブジェクト指向の解釈されたスクリプト言語です。PHP言語に関する質問に使用されます。

10
PHPでPDFドキュメントをプレビュー画像に変換するにはどうすればよいですか?[閉まっている]
閉まっている。この質問はスタックオーバーフローのガイドラインを満たしていません。現在、回答を受け付けていません。 この質問を改善してみませんか?Stack Overflowのトピックとなるように質問を更新します。 2年前休業。 この質問を改善する PDFドキュメントの一部を画像ファイルにレンダリングするために必要なライブラリ、拡張機能などは何ですか? 私が見つけたほとんどのPHP PDFライブラリはPDFドキュメントの作成を中心にしていますが、Webでの使用に適した画像形式にドキュメントをレンダリングする簡単な方法はありますか? 私たちの環境はLAMPスタックです。
199 php  image  pdf  lamp 

13
PHPの非同期シェルexec
シェルスクリプトを呼び出す必要があるが、出力はまったく気にしないPHPスクリプトを持っています。シェルスクリプトは多数のSOAP呼び出しを実行し、完了するのに時間がかかるため、応答を待機している間、PHPリクエストの速度を低下させたくありません。実際、PHPリクエストは、シェルプロセスを終了せずに終了できるはずです。 私は様々に見てきましたexec()、shell_exec()、pcntl_fork()、などの機能、それらのどれもまさに私が望むものを提供するように見えるん。(または、もしそうなら、それは私には明確ではありません。)何か提案はありますか?
199 php  asynchronous  shell 

11
PHPで配列をエコーまたは印刷する方法は?
私はこの配列を持っています Array ( [data] => Array ( [0] => Array ( [page_id] => 204725966262837 [type] => WEBSITE ) [1] => Array ( [page_id] => 163703342377960 [type] => COMMUNITY ) ) ) 私の質問は、この構造なしでコンテンツをエコーする方法ですか?私は試した foreach ($results as $result) { echo $result->type; echo "<br>"; }
198 php  arrays 

12
PHPでファイルを解凍します
ファイルを解凍したいのですが、これで問題なく動作します system('unzip File.zip'); しかし、私はURLを通してファイル名を渡す必要があり、それを機能させることができません、これは私が持っているものです。 $master = $_GET["master"]; system('unzip $master.zip'); 何が欠けていますか?私はそれが私が見落としている小さくて愚かなものでなければならないことを知っています。 ありがとうございました、
198 php  unzip 

30
関数からの複数の戻り
次のような2つの戻り値を持つ関数を持つことは可能ですか? function test($testvar) { // Do something return $var1; return $var2; } もしそうなら、どのように私は各リターンを別々に得ることができますか?
198 php 

11
PHPのecho、print、print_rの違いは何ですか?
私はたくさん使っechoていprint_rますが、ほとんど使っていませんprint。 私echoはマクロでprint_r、のエイリアスですvar_dump。 しかし、それは違いを説明する標準的な方法ではありません。
197 php 

6
Access-Control-Allow-Originをバイパスする方法
私は自分のサーバーにajax呼び出しを行って、これらのajax呼び出しを防止するように設定したプラットフォームでサーバーにデータをフェッチして、サーバーのデータベースから取得したデータを表示する必要があります。私のajaxスクリプトは機能しています。サーバーのphpスクリプトにデータを送信して、処理できるようにすることができます。ただし、処理されたデータは、"Access-Control-Allow-Origin" そのプラットフォームのソース/コアにアクセスできません。そのため、許可されていないスクリプトは削除できません。(P / SIはGoogle Chromeのコンソールを使用し、このエラーを発見しました) 以下に示すAjaxコード: $.ajax({ type: "GET", url: "http://example.com/retrieve.php", data: "id=" + id + "&url=" + url, dataType: 'json', cache: false, success: function(data) { var friend = data[1]; var blog = data[2]; $('#user').html("<b>Friends: </b>"+friend+"<b><br> Blogs: </b>"+blog); } }); またはJSON上記のajaxスクリプトに相当するコードはありますか?JSON許されると思います。 誰かが私を助けてくれることを願っています。
197 javascript  php  jquery  ajax  cors 

6
匿名の再帰的なPHP関数
再帰的かつ匿名のPHP関数を持つことは可能ですか?これは機能させるための私の試みですが、関数名を渡しません。 $factorial = function( $n ) use ( $factorial ) { if( $n <= 1 ) return 1; return $factorial( $n - 1 ) * $n; }; print $factorial( 5 ); これは階乗を実装するための悪い方法であることも知っています。これは単なる例です。

18
PHP Get Site URL Protocol-httpとhttps
現在のサイトURLプロトコルを確立するための小さな関数を記述しましたが、SSLがなく、httpsで動作するかどうかをテストする方法がわかりません。これが正しいかどうか教えていただけますか? function siteURL() { $protocol = (!empty($_SERVER['HTTPS']) && $_SERVER['HTTPS'] !== 'off' || $_SERVER['SERVER_PORT'] == 443) ? "https://" : "http://"; $domainName = $_SERVER['HTTP_HOST'].'/'; return $protocol.$domainName; } define( 'SITE_URL', siteURL() ); 上記のようにする必要がありますか、それとも単に行うことができますか?: function siteURL() { $protocol = 'http://'; $domainName = $_SERVER['HTTP_HOST'].'/' return $protocol.$domainName; } define( 'SITE_URL', siteURL() ); SSLでは、アンカータグのURLがhttpを使用していても、サーバーはURLをhttpsに自動的に変換しませんか?プロトコルを確認する必要はありますか? ありがとうございました!
197 php  url  ssl 

12
SimpleXMLElementオブジェクトから値を取得する
私はこのようなものを持っています: $url = "http://ws.geonames.org/findNearbyPostalCodes?country=pl&placename="; $url .= rawurlencode($city[$i]); $xml = simplexml_load_file($url); echo $url."\n"; $cityCode[] = array( 'city' => $city[$i], 'lat' => $xml->code[0]->lat, 'lng' => $xml->code[0]->lng ); ジオネームからXMLをダウンロードすることになっています。私がprint_r($xml)取得した場合: SimpleXMLElement Object ( [code] => Array ( [0] => SimpleXMLElement Object ( [postalcode] => 01-935 [name] => Warszawa [countryCode] => PL [lat] => 52.25 …
197 php  simplexml 

13
URL文字列からパラメーターを取得する方法は?
$_POST["url"]値としていくつかのURL文字列を持つHTMLフォームフィールドがあります。値の例は次のとおりです。 https://example.com/test/1234?email=xyz@test.com https://example.com/test/1234?basic=2&email=xyz2@test.com https://example.com/test/1234?email=xyz3@test.com https://example.com/test/1234?email=xyz4@test.com&testin=123 https://example.com/test/the-page-here/1234?someurl=key&email=xyz5@test.com 等 emailこれらのURL /値からパラメーターのみを取得するにはどうすればよいですか? ブラウザのアドレスバーからこれらの文字列を取得していないことに注意してください。
197 php  url-parsing 

8
PHP変数を次のページに渡す
とてもシンプルに見えますが、良い方法が見つかりません。 変数を作成する最初のページで言う $myVariable = "Some text"; そして、そのページに対するフォームのアクションは "Page2.php"です。Page2.phpでは、どのようにしてその変数にアクセスできますか?セッションでできることは知っていますが、単純な文字列では多すぎると思います。単純な文字列(ファイル名)を渡すだけで十分です。 どうすればこれを達成できますか? ありがとう!
196 php  variables  session 

9
列から一意の値を選択する
次のタイプの情報を含むMySQLテーブルがあります。 Date product 2011-12-12 azd 2011-12-12 yxm 2011-12-10 sdx 2011-12-10 ssdd この表からデータを取得するために使用するスクリプトの例を次に示します。 <?php $con = mysql_connect("localhost","username","password"); if (!$con) { die('Could not connect: ' . mysql_error()); } mysql_select_db("db", $con); $sql=mysql_query("SELECT * FROM buy ORDER BY Date"); while($row = mysql_fetch_array($sql)) { echo "<li><a href='http://www.website/". $row['Date'].".html'>buy ". date("j, M Y", strtotime($row["Date"]))."</a></li>"; } mysql_close($con); …
196 php  mysql  sql 

5
PHPでヒアドキュメントを使用する利点は何ですか?[閉まっている]
現在のところ、この質問はQ&A形式には適していません。回答は事実、参考文献、専門知識によって裏付けられると期待していますが、この質問は、議論、議論、投票、または拡張ディスカッションを求める可能性があります。この質問を改善でき、再開できると思われる場合は、ヘルプセンターにアクセスしてください。 7年前休業。 PHPでヒアドキュメントを使用する利点は何ですか?例を示すことができますか?
196 php  heredoc 

6
PHPの::(二重コロン)と->(矢印)の違いは何ですか?
PHPのメソッドにアクセスする方法は2つありますが、違いは何ですか? $response->setParameter('foo', 'bar'); そして sfConfig::set('foo', 'bar'); ->変数の関数には(より大記号の付いたダッシュまたはシェブロン)が使用され::、クラスの関数には(二重コロン)が使用されていると想定しています。正しい? ある=>だけで、配列内のデータを割り当てるために使用される代入演算子?=これは、変数をインスタンス化または変更するために使用される代入演算子とは対照的ですか?
196 php 

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.